  9. WARNING!!!!! I am Premiere Lifetime Member and I went into Emby Version 4.0.2.0 and went into Movies in my web browser. In looking at the list of movies I had seen a lot of cover art was not showing up for some reason. So I went back one screen and I clicked on the 3 dots and selected Refresh Metadata and selected to REPLACE ALL METADATA and checked the box to Replace all the Images. At that point it just went through and deleted everything! GONE! Nothing! All deleted! Posted on the Emby site about this and this was the reply... "Ok it looks like you did actually use the delete media function, and for whatever reason it may have gone up an extra level when deleting the movie folder. I will have to add more logging to confirm this. I believe we have noticed this issue being associated with the database upgrade from 3.5, but it does not occur on newly created libraries. It is already resolved for the next release so that it will not happen again. I apologize for the disruption. Luke" Over 1000 movies GONE! Seeing that unRAID has NO WAY to recover deleted files....Emby just toasted me! (Along with unRAID not having a snapshot backup system and being just parity. I have been a unRAIND user for a very long time. First time I lost everything. Now I am looking for a solution that could have saved me with such a large BUG.

  23. Hi... I run a 20 TB system and have been for going into 5 years on the road with it. I run all standard platter drives in the system and use SSD just for the Cache. Right now it has a 8TB parity and five 4 TB drives. (I put in the larger parity when I needed a new drive, so I did that for expansion if needed.) It is just part of our routine to shut the server down when we move and turn it back on when we arrive and setup. Same with our Dish Hooper, we always unplug it while traveling. It just becomes routine to do it like anything else you need to do. As far as heat goes, I have it in it's own cabinet and just have one 3" fan pulling air out of the top of it. It does very well and I leave the drives spun up even though I really do not need to. The issue I found, with my system, is that if I am watching something off the server and then a new file needed to be written and it needs to spin up a drive, the show then buffers while that I/O is waiting. So I now down don't spin them down. The big thing in the coach however is the full Ubnt UniFi Wi-Fi system that is running with dual band AP's inside and out and three switches.
